Walt Disney World, Co. June 1976 to November 1995

Director Disney University February to November 1996. Created and taught the

Disney Keys to Service Excellence program to external audiences. Three hour

seminar program taught off Disney property. Developed into a $1 million plus revenue

stream.

Director of Casting November 1988 to February 1995 (Employment). Led

department of over 110 cast members and 30 contract employees, with annual budget

in excess of $7 million. The department hired between 12 and 18 thousand

individuals each year in a variety of capacities and programs.

Directed the efforts of five managers in nine separate groups: Professional Staffing,

Diversity Recruiting, Recasting, General Employment, College Relations,

International Staffing, Employment Programs, Staff Housing, and I-9 monitoring

and record keeping. Put in place part-time recruiting programs that enabled the

company to shift percentage of fulltime to part-time employees

Acted as the chief visa officer for the company. Lobbied Congress for the inclusion

of the Q-visa in the Immigration Reform Act of 1988.

2

Developed the staffing strategies for the build up of the Disney Hotels and for the

opening of the Disney/MGM Theme Park & two water parks.

August 1991 May 1992 on temporary assignment to Euro Disney. Responsible for

opening staffing strategy. Created and executed the outside France recruiting

strategy that enabled the team to hire 12,000 people in 13 weeks. Also worked with

the French Hotel Schools to provide grand opening staff and staff for first three

weeks of operation.

Manager of College, International, and Professional Staffing May 1980 to November

1988. Built the Professional Staffing team that staffed EPCOT Center. Created the

Walt Disney World College Program and built the college recruiting network for the

company.

Developed and executed the strategy that allowed EPCOT Center World Showcase

to be staffed by individuals from the countries represented. Traveled to all of the

World Showcase countries to establish the recruiting networks that are used.

Created the International Staffing team

Professional Staffing Representative June 1978 to May 1980, responsible for

manpower planning, sourcing, recruiting, interviewing, and hiring professional

employees for a number of divisions of WDWCo. Developed the F&B Summer

Assistant Supervisor program and the F&B training program that reduced F&B

management turnover by 80%.

Administrative Experience:

Created the Hotel & Restaurant Management Department for Central Texas College Europe

Accredited by the Southwest Association

Established junior college programs on 35 military bases in Turkey, Italy, Spain, Germany,

The Netherlands, and England. Developed curriculum, wrote all syllabi, hired instructors and

integrated CTC programs with Army education centers. Purpose of the program was to

prepare soldiers returning from service for their transition back to the civilian world as the

military shrank at the end of the Viet Nam War.
